I would turn it around and say:

stop|restart            - affects only daemon
start|cstop|crestart    - affects all (cache, daemon)

This has the advantage that the actual behavior isn't changed and that people 
not knowing what they are doing, don't wipe the cache by default. Adding a 
hint (echo to stdout) on stop|restart how to kill the cache should also 
enlighten ppl.
